cuchulucputils/linux.py Normal file
View file

@ -0,0 +1,136 @@
#!/usr/bin/python3
import os
import distro
from subprocess import call, DEVNULL
import re
import json
def shell_command(command):
return_call=call(command, shell=True)
if return_call> 0:
print('Error: cannot execute command '+command+' with return code '+str(return_call)+'\n')
return False
else:
return True
def check_distro(arr_command):
distro_id=distro.id()
if not distro_id in arr_command:
print("Sorry, you cannot get the distro\n\n")
return False
else:
return distro_id
def install_package(package):
distro_id=distro.id()
if distro_id=='debian' or distro_id=='ubuntu':
return shell_command('sudo DEBIAN_FRONTEND="noninteractive" apt-get install -y {}'.format(package[distro_id]))
elif distro_id=='fedora' or distro_id=='almalinux' or distro_id=='rocky' or distro_id=='centos':
return shell_command('sudo dnf install -y {}'.format(package[distro_id]))
elif distro_id=='arch':
return shell_command('sudo pacman -S --noconfirm {}'.format(package[distro_id]))
def patch_file(original_file, patch_file, no_patch_distro=True):
distro_id=check_distro(original_file)
if not distro_id:
if no_patch_distro:
print('This distro ignored for patch')
return True
else:
print('This distro need a patch')
return False
if distro_id in original_file:
return shell_command("sudo patch {} < {}".format(original_file[distro_id], patch_file[distro_id]))
else:
print('Ignored file for patching for distro '+distro_id)
return True
def systemd_service(action, service):
distro_id=check_distro(service)
if not distro_id:
return False
if distro_id in service:
return shell_command('sudo systemctl {} {}'.format(action, service[distro_id]))
else:
print('Cannot restart service')
return True
def exec(command):
distro_id=check_distro(command)
if not distro_id:
return False
if distro_id in command:
return shell_command(command[distro_id])
else:
print('Cannot execute the command in this distro')
return True
def sed(arr_sed):
distro_id=check_distro(arr_sed)
if not distro_id:
return 0
return shell_command("sudo sed -i \"s/{}/{}/g\" {}".format(arr_sed[distro_id][0], arr_sed[distro_id][1], arr_sed[distro_id][2]))
def json_log(message, error=0, status=0, progress=0, no_progress=0, return_message=0, result=None):
log={'error': error, 'status': status, 'progress': progress, 'no_progress': no_progress, 'message': message}
if result:
log['result']=result
if not return_message:
print(json.dumps(log))
else:
return json.dumps(log)

cuchulucputils/unix.py Normal file
View file

@ -0,0 +1,86 @@
#!/usr/bin/env python3
import time
import os
import re
import argparse
import json
import pwd
import sys
import crypt
from subprocess import call, DEVNULL
def add_user(user, password='', group='', user_directory='', shell='/usr/sbin/nologin'):
if user_directory=='':
user_directory='/home/'+user
try:
user_pwd=pwd.getpwnam(user)
return (False, 'User exists')
except KeyError:
# add user
if password!='':
salt=crypt.mksalt(crypt.METHOD_SHA512)
password='-p \"%s\"' % crypt.crypt(password, salt).replace('$', '\$')
if group!='':
# Buggy, need fix.
stat_group=os.stat('/home/%s' % user_directory)
gid=stat_group.st_gid
func_user="sudo useradd -m -s %s -g %i %s -d %s %s" % (shell, gid, password, user_directory, user)
else:
func_user="sudo useradd -m -s %s %s -d %s %s" % (shell, password, user_directory, user)
if call(func_user, shell=True, stdout=DEVNULL) > 0:
return (False, 'Error executing useradd command')
else:
return (True, '')
def change_password(user, new_password):
try:
user_pwd=pwd.getpwnam(user)
if call("sudo echo \"%s:%s\" | sudo chpasswd" % (user, new_password), shell=True, stdout=DEVNULL) > 0:
return (False, 'I cannot change password, permissions?')
else:
return (True, 'Change password successfully')
except KeyError:
return (False, 'I cannot change password, user exists?')
def del_user(user):
if call("sudo userdel -r %s" % user, shell=True, stdout=DEVNULL, stderr=DEVNULL) > 0:
return (False, '')
else:
return (True, 'Deleted user successfully')
def mkdir_sh(directory):
if call("sudo mkdir -p %s" % directory, shell=True) > 0:
return (False, '')
else:
return (True, 'Created directory successfully %s' % directory)
